Output 52db10352fc8aaa3ddc4eff078b94270f20e4d5cbe388262dc0b512e1dd1b3ec:18

value
1595000
script pubkey
OP_0 OP_PUSHBYTES_20 0d59da52a57cd7ba803813fd6c88f160ca872b47
address
bc1qp4va55490ntm4qpcz07kez83vr9gw268xzjskw
transaction
52db10352fc8aaa3ddc4eff078b94270f20e4d5cbe388262dc0b512e1dd1b3ec
spent
true